Key facts from Kb Home at Baseline & Higley's documents

Reflects the 2002 governing documents — figures and rules are as originally recorded and may have changed since.

Community type
Planned community (KB HOME at Baseline & Higley) (Recitals A, Definitions – Project)
Legal name
Baseline & Higley Homeowners Association (Recitals B, Definitions – Association)
Governing law
Arizona Revised Statutes (A.R.S., specifically A.R.S. §§ 33-1803, 33-741, 10-3202, 10-3833) (Sections 5.15, 6.4, 8.1, 8.6, 8.10, etc.)
Assessments & dues
Maximum Annual Assessment for fiscal year ending Dec 31, 2002: $60.00 per month per Lot (Section 8.6)
Special assessments
Allowed for capital improvements or extraordinary expenses, approved by at least 2/3 of each class of Members voting in person or by proxy (Section 8.7)
Collections & liens
Lien in favor of Association against each Lot securing Assessments; prior to all except taxes and first mortgage; Recording of Declaration perfects lien; foreclosure allowed under Arizona mortgage foreclosure law (Section 8.2)
Reserves & fees
Association may collect and maintain Funds in reserve for any use referred to in Section 9.1 (common good) (Section 9.1)
Pets
Only generally recognized house pets (as determined by Board), kept as domestic pets, not for commercial purposes; no animals that cause annoyance to other Owners/Occupants allowed (Section 5.2)
Leasing & rentals
Yes (Section 5.14)
Parking & vehicles
Prohibited on Property or adjacent roadways unless inside a fully-enclosed garage or in areas designated by Board (which may prohibit completely) (Section 5.12)
Fences
On corner lots, no fence, wall, hedge, shrub obstructing sight lines between 2 ft and 6 ft above street within 25 ft triangular area; no tree unless foliage maintained at sufficient height (Section 5.13)
Architectural approval
Yes, Committee approval required for any Improvement or landscaping Visible From Neighboring Property; approval also required for storage sheds, basketball goals, solar panels, antennas, and any change in exterior appearance (Sections 4.1, 5.7, 5.9, 5.10, 5.11, 5.15)
Home business
Allowed if not apparent by sight/sound/smell, conforms to zoning, no door-to-door solicitation, no customer parking, not a nuisance or hazardous (Section 5.1)
Signs & flags
Only signs required by legal proceedings, two address signs (max 72 sq in each), for sale/lease signs (max 5 sq ft), and Declarant’s advertising signs during construction/sales period (Section 5.16)
Voting & meetings
Two classes: Class A (other Owners) – one vote per Lot; Class B (Declarant and Designated Builder) – three votes per Lot owned. Class B automatically converts to Class A upon 75% Lots conveyed to non-Declarant/Builder, 20 years from recordi (Section 7.2)
Amendments
Amendment requires vote or written consent of Members owning not less than 67% of all Lots and Declarant (so long as Declarant is an Owner); amendment effective upon Recording (Section 12.2)
Amenities
Common Areas include internal Private Streets, landscaping, dusk-to-dawn lighting, pedestrian walkway in central Common Area, drainage improvements; no specific amenities like pool or clubhouse mentioned (Sections 3.1 (definition of Common Areas)

Extracted from the recorded governing documents and cited to them; may be incomplete and is not legal advice — verify against the official documents below.
